The Celtic fans are incredibly fond of Ange Postecoglou for the success and style of football the Australian brought to the club.
Securing seven trophies out of nine, which included the record-breaking eighth-domestic treble, Postecoglou left Celtic a hero after dragging the team out of the depths at the end of the disastrous COVID season.
Now at Tottenham Hotspur, the former Celtic manager will be hoping that this season he can bring some silverware to the trophy-starved club.
And that is exactly what former Barcelona youngster David Babunski told the media after he was asked to comment on the Australian and what he could bring to Spurs.
Postecoglou was ‘one of the best’ ever
Who is David Babunski I hear you all ask. Well, Babunski is Dundee United’s new summer signing. He was at Barcelona for ten years but didn’t make a first-team appearance for the Catalan giants.
He moved from Barcelona to Red Star Belgrade where after just one season, he eventually ended up at Yokohama F Marinos under, yep you guessed it, Ange Postecoglou when the Australian arrived at the J League club in 2018.
Babunski said of Ange, [The Courier], “A fantastic coach, probably one of the best I have had.
“I was in a dressing room with Pep Guardiola and Luis Enrique back in the day, but when Ange arrived at Yokohama Marinos, I was really impressed.
“I did an interview from Spain where they called to ask me about him when he signed for Tottenham and I told them if they let him work, he might achieve some success – he is obsessed with that.
“He did a good job when he was in Scotland.”
